Output 5e37388cc438cc32f8a46d0eebfe30452d31127aed51fcb03e0d1ed4de14b2a5:0

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3bf2d1953b2a0273dde1cc983b65b8cb2929570 OP_EQUAL
address
3KY2i6y4JThBrWFkmtjj4M9WHZ7sui45nZ
transaction
5e37388cc438cc32f8a46d0eebfe30452d31127aed51fcb03e0d1ed4de14b2a5
confirmations
187916
spent
true